  • Four management areas that differentiate excellent dairy producers from those that are average with Brad Guse
    Jul 14 2026

    Join Brad Guse from BMO and host Kimmi Devaney for a discussion about what sets excellent dairy producers apart from the rest. Learn which financial metrics they focus on, risk management strategies and how they build a great team culture while fine-tuning their own leadership skills.

    Here is an episode overview.

    • [~2:10] The financial metrics that excellent dairy producers focus on
    • [~5:50] The role high beef prices play and how it has influenced dairy financials
    • [~7:15] How risk management can make a huge difference for dairy operations
    • [~8:35] How culture and leadership impact profitability
    • [~9:55] Examples of how successful dairies build a productive team culture
    • [~12:30] Characteristics of great leaders
    • [~14:05] Tips to improve overall communication between all levels of employees
    • [~17:25] Steps to grow your leadership skills
    • [~19:05] The types of questions excellent dairy producers are asking their advisers
    • [~21:15] What causes an A player to fall into the C category?
    • [~24:55] How someone can move from being a C player to an A player faster
    • [~26:30] How peer groups and advisory boards can help producers identify and improve their blind spots
    • [~28:20] Qualities to look for when assembling a peer group
    • [~32:20] Outlook for the remainder of 2026
    • [~38:20] Rapid-fire questions
